[Bug 94382] Re: "Guided - use entire disk" is not clear enough for normal users

2009-04-07 Thread Jason Spiro
This bug bit me today. I accidentally erased my friend's main HDD and all the digital photos on it. In Feisty beta, you wrote: "Guided - use entire disk". That text is not clear enough. In Jaunty beta, you write: "Use the entire disk". Still not clear enough. I think you should write:
